Size and Shape
When it comes to choosing a toilet for a small space, size and shape are crucial factors to consider. You want a toilet that is compact and can fit snugly into the available space. The good news is that there are many toilet models designed specifically for small spaces. These toilets are often called “compact toilets” or “space-saving toilets.” They are designed to be shorter in length and narrower in width, making them perfect for small bathrooms, powder rooms, or even RVs. When measuring the space for your new toilet, make sure to consider the height, width, and length of the toilet, as well as any obstacles such as plumbing fixtures or electrical outlets.
A compact toilet can be a game-changer for small spaces. Not only do they save floor space, but they can also create a sense of openness and airiness in the room. When shopping for a compact toilet, look for models with a shorter length, typically around 25 inches or less. You should also consider the shape of the toilet. A round toilet bowl can be more compact than an elongated one, but it may not be as comfortable. On the other hand, an elongated toilet bowl can provide more comfort, but it may require more space. Ultimately, the choice of size and shape will depend on your personal preferences and the specific needs of your small space.
Bowl Shape and Height
The shape and height of the toilet bowl are also important factors to consider. A toilet with a comfortable bowl shape and height can make all the difference in your bathroom experience. The most common bowl shapes are round and elongated. Round bowls are typically more compact, while elongated bowls provide more comfort and are often preferred by users. When it comes to bowl height, you’ll want to consider a toilet with a height that is comfortable for you and your family members. Standard toilet heights range from 14 to 16 inches, but you can also find toilets with higher or lower heights.
A comfortable bowl shape and height can be especially important for people with mobility issues or disabilities. Look for toilets with a higher bowl height, typically around 17 to 19 inches, which can make it easier to stand up and sit down. You should also consider a toilet with a comfort height feature, which can provide additional support and comfort. Some toilets also come with an elongated bowl and a higher seat, which can provide the best of both worlds. When shopping for a toilet, make sure to read reviews and product descriptions to find the perfect combination of bowl shape and height for your needs.
Flushing System
The flushing system is another critical factor to consider when buying a toilet for a small space. The flushing system determines how much water is used per flush and how efficiently the toilet can remove waste. There are several types of flushing systems available, including single-flush, dual-flush, and pressure-assisted flush. Single-flush toilets use a set amount of water per flush, while dual-flush toilets allow you to choose between a full or partial flush. Pressure-assisted flush toilets use a combination of water and air pressure to remove waste.
When choosing a flushing system, consider the water efficiency and noise level. Dual-flush toilets can be a great option for small spaces, as they provide flexibility and can help reduce water consumption. Pressure-assisted flush toilets can be more effective at removing waste, but they can also be noisier and more expensive. Look for toilets with a high MaP score, which measures the toilet’s ability to remove waste. A higher MaP score indicates a more efficient flushing system. You should also consider the noise level of the flushing system, as some toilets can be quite loud. A quiet flushing system can be especially important for small spaces, where noise can be more noticeable.
Water Efficiency
Water efficiency is a critical factor to consider when buying a toilet for a small space. Toilets can account for up to 30% of a household’s water consumption, so choosing a water-efficient toilet can make a big difference. Look for toilets with the WaterSense label, which indicates that the toilet meets EPA standards for water efficiency. WaterSense toilets use 1.28 gallons per flush or less, which can help reduce water consumption and lower your water bill.
When shopping for a water-efficient toilet, consider the type of flushing system and the gallons per flush (GPF). Dual-flush toilets can be a great option, as they provide flexibility and can help reduce water consumption. How do I measure my bathroom space to choose the right toilet size?
Measuring your bathroom space is a crucial step in choosing the right toilet size. Start by measuring the length and width of the space where the toilet will be installed. Take note of any obstacles, such as plumbing fixtures or doorways, that may affect the toilet’s placement. You should also measure the distance between the wall behind the toilet and the center of the drainpipe, as this will determine the type of toilet you can install. Don’t forget to consider the height of the ceiling and any windows or other features that may impact the toilet’s installation.
Once you have your measurements, you can use them to compare different toilet models and find one that will fit comfortably in your space. Keep in mind that some toilets may have specific installation requirements, such as a minimum distance from the wall or a specific type of drainpipe. By taking accurate measurements and doing your research, you can ensure that your new toilet will fit seamlessly into your small bathroom space. Can I install a toilet in a small space with limited plumbing access?
Installing a toilet in a small space with limited plumbing access can be challenging, but it’s not impossible. In fact, many toilet manufacturers offer models that are specifically designed for installation in small or hard-to-reach spaces. These toilets often come with flexible or offset drainpipes, which can help to navigate tight spaces and simplify the installation process. You may also want to consider a macerating toilet, which uses a grinding system to break down waste and can be installed up to 20 feet away from the main drain line.
If you’re planning to install a toilet in a small space with limited plumbing access, it’s essential to work with a professional plumber who has experience with complex installations. They can help you to assess the space and determine the best course of action. In some cases, you may need to use specialized tools or materials to complete the installation. However, with the right expertise and equipment, you can successfully install a toilet in even the most challenging small spaces.
